I had EBC green stuff pads on my GC8 impreza, equipped with STi 4 piston brakes, and BOZZ SPEED slotted rotors.
The EBC pads warped my rotors within 1,500 miles. I didn't do any hard driving, such as track driving... I did break them in, did everything I was supposed to. I got my rotors replaced, and the same exact thing happened again. That's when I figured out that the pads were to blame. I immediately replaced the pads with BOZZ SPEED race pads, which were supposed to be super abrasive... and yet, they didn't warp my rotors.
